Bigscal Technologies Pvt. Ltd. is a leading software development company in India.1st Floor, B - Millenium Point, Lal Darwaja Station Rd, opp. Gabani Kidney Hospital, Surat, Gujarat 395003, India
395003, Surat
India
Engagement Rings in Chelsea, MI111 S Main St
48118, Chelsea
United States See more